Ticket: FIELD-2281 — Expired credentials blocking offline sync

For the weekly sync: the Heronpath field-survey app's offline mode stopped reconciling on Monday because the cached sync token expired while crews were out of coverage. Surveys queued locally are intact, but uploads fail silently until re-auth. We've extended token lifetime to 30 days and reissued credentials. The replacement key for the internal sync service follows.

service key, fafog-fahaf: vxb3-x55

Finance Review — Pricing, the Bramblefox Line. Quick summary for sales leads: margins on Bramblefox Core are holding up nicely, but the Plus tier is underpriced against what buyers are actually willing to pay. We're recommending a modest list-price bump and tighter discounting. Nothing changes until leadership signs off. The confidential thinking behind this sits just below.

confidential, kagup-bafog: Fraaxax Group is in early talks to buy Soroxox Group for about $343.8 million. The Olidor launch date is June 14, and nothing goes to the press before then. Legal wants the Aldmirek Logistics term sheet signed before July 23.

**Q: How are requests traced across Quillbase microservices?**

Every inbound request at the Gatewren edge gets a trace ID, propagated via the `x-qb-trace` header. Services must forward it unchanged; the Spanloom collector stitches spans into a single timeline. Trace data is retained 30 days and contains no payload bodies, only metadata. Sampling is 100% for authenticated traffic. The full retention and access-control policy is documented on the internal page below.

operations page: https://jira.qorvelsys.internal/browse/pages/browse/pages

**Alert: image-slim pipeline regression (Parework registry).** Fires when a slimmed container image exceeds 120% of its seven-day baseline size, indicating the layer-pruning stage was skipped or a dependency snuck in unstripped. Reviewers should verify the slimming manifest before approving Dockerfile changes, since base-image bumps are the usual culprit. Triage steps and the baseline dashboard are documented on the internal page.

runbook for badug-kadup: https://confluence.zemvarlabs.internal/projects/browse/display/projects/bd1b